    hi list,
    this afternoon i decided to update my freebsd 5.1 box to 5.2. i wanted to
    try the binary update through sysinstall to save myself some time. i've done
    the source update on my server some months ago to 4-stable, and it worked
    just fine.
    this is what i did:

    selected "base", "src"(did not get updated) and "man" to be updated, entered
    the devices and mountpoints and started. after beeing prompted to restart, i
    gladly saw the 5.2-release beeing showed at boot and just after that the
    kernel crashed with the following message:

    Fatal trap 12: page fault while in kernel mode
    fault code: supervisor read, page not present
    panic: page fault.

    now, after unsuccessfully retrying the proceedure and even trying to
    "downgrade" back to 5.1 by booting the 5.1iso and selecting upgrade, i've
    booted freesbie and now i'm stuck. is there any hope to save my
    installation? i thought of copying the /boot partition from freesbie over to
    my wasted 5.1 installation, just to get it booting and then retry updating
    by source. i would really love to get all back up like before i started all
    this. the system was except some trouble with my soundcard perfect!

    to be frank, i didn't read the UPDATING file, because i thought it would
    relay to updating by source, so i'm aware of my faulty act.

    i would really appreciate help. i'm totally new to this kind of problem with
    freebsd; it never rejected to boot on me.
